Brief background:

Since my father wanted to be shure to circumnavigate without engine failure, he opted for the "best", but shure the most expensive option and bought for his lifetime trip a new Volvo Penta engine.
Already almost home, in Turkey it gave up completely. The Volvo workshop thought of a complete rebuild of the 2500h old engine, almost new in my opinion..
They said it would take 11 days for this job. 5 weeks after the 11 days and €6800.- just spare parts they were finished and we took off with high spirits. 60 engine hours later the engine is a real wreck again. Crankshaft bearings in the oilsump, scratchmarks in cylinder 3 and four, as well as marks on the crankshaft of those two cylinders.
We are now since seven days here in a
Athens, Greece where we sailed into Alimos Marina, having no working engine at all. It took these seven days to dismantle the engine. We meanwhile have to get home urgently. Thanks very much for support, meanwhile Volvo got going, we got reply of directors from Sweden, Belgium and Germany! :-)
Yesterday evening we were in the workshop when the crankshaft was pulled from the block, the plates holding the bearings were all installed wrong way around, the metal of bearing 3 and 4 had flown because of mean overheting, we found even cleaning paper and parts of sealant in the engine!
The costs of a rebuild are now higher then getting a new engine..

Cowes to St Malo TIMED Race 2024

Organized by the Royal Ocean Racing Club since 1929, the Cowes to St Malo Race is a true RORC Classic. Starting from the Royal Yacht Squadron Line, Cowes, IOW, a magnificent spectacle can be watched from The Parade, Cowes. The Cowes to St Malo Race is part of the RORC Season’s Points Championship, the world’s largest offshore racing series. Dating back to 1906, the Cowes to St Malo Race precedes all of the world’s famous races including the Fastnet Race.
